V K Jirsa and H Haken (1996)

Field theory of electromagnetic brain activity

PHYSICAL REVIEW LETTERS 77(5):960–963.

A semiquantitative nonlinear field theory of the brain is presented derived from the quasimicroscopic conversion properties of neural populations. Realistic anatomical connectivity conditions like long range excitation and short range inhibition are used. Predictions of our field equation are checked against experimental MEG results.,
